Lake Keowee
The beautiful pristine waters of Lake Keowee are a delight for those looking for relaxation or recreation. Lake Keowee is a man-made reservoir located in Upstate South Carolina, developed beginning in 1971 to serve the needs of Duke Energy and for public recreation. The Lake is approximately 26 miles long, 3 miles wide, with an average depth of 54 feet, and a shoreline measured at 300 miles in total, and is approximately 800 feet above sea level.
